#096, Bharata- Do not BELIEVE WHAT WOMEN SAY

2-100=49 Sanskrit Verse
 

Context: Bharata approached Rama in the forest at Chitrakuut` with a request to return to Ayodhya and rule the kingdom. Rama taught him the art of Statecraft. ENGLISH Are you keeping the women peaceful? Are you keeping them well-protected? I believe you are not believing the words of these women and telling them your secrets.
